Kamakura was once Japan's medieval capital — and an hour from Yokohama by local train, it still feels like a different world. We skip the tour buses and travel via the local train, which is remarkably efficient here in Japan. We visit three places most itineraries miss. Hokokuji's bamboo grove is quiet enough to hear the stalks in the wind — we sit down here for matcha served in the grove itself. Zeniarai Benzaiten is a Shinto shrine built inside a cave, reached through a tunnel carved into the hillside — atmospheric, a little mysterious, and genuinely surprising. We finish at Hasedera, where tiered gardens and a gigantic Buddha statue give way to an open view across the rooftops to Sagami Bay. This will be a relaxed, not rushed tour. - Meet at Yokohama Port gate. Brief introduction and transit overview before we head to the station. - Board local train from Yokohama to Kamakura. Scenic coastal ride — approximately 55 minutes. - Arrive Kamakura. Short bus ride to Hokokuji Temple — a working Zen temple with a private bamboo grove. We sit for matcha served inside the grove itself. - Walk to Zeniarai Benzaiten — a Shinto cave shrine hidden in the hillside. Enter through a tunnel, emerge into an incense-filled rock courtyard. - Make our way to Hasedera Temple. Tiered gardens, an eleven-metre gilt Kannon, and a sea view over Sagami Bay. - Lunch break near Hase — local options for ramen, soba, or light bites at your own pace. - Return train from Kamakura to Yokohama. - Arrive in Yokohama. Walk back to port together — comfortably back before 15:00 all-aboard.
